Using the System
With an Internet connection and a web browser, you can access the Internet-based Surface Metrology Algorithm Testing System. After login to the system, you can perform surface finish analysis and download reference data with calculated surface parameters from the database. On the main page of the homepage, you can view four options: Reference Software for 2D Surface Analysis, 2D Virtual SRM Database, Reference Software for 3D Surface Analysis, and 3D Virtual SRM Database. By clicking on Reference Software for 2D Surface Analysis
or 2D Virtual SRM Database, you can access the 2D database and use 2D analysis tools. On the other hand, you can access 3D analysis tools and 3D Virtual SRM Database by clicking on Reference Software for 3D Surface Analysis and 3D Virtual SRM Database. After you choose one of these options,
you can view more help screens on the Help menu at the upper right corner of the screen.
